| Description |
Folklife grants are awarded to nonprofit organizations, folklorists, and traditional artists engaged in projects that preserve and perpetuate folklife traditions or educate the public about North Carolina's folk cultural heritage. |
| Grantee Eligibility |
Documentary grants provide funds to folklorists, working independently or employed by a non-profit organization, and to traditional artists for projects that document the state's cultural traditions and the work of artists who are part of those traditions.
Public Program grants provide support to non-profit organizations for public presentations and programs featuring the state's folklife traditions.
Salary Assistance grants are provided on a limited basis to organizations that create a staff position for a professional folklorist. |
